I will make this hood shortly, only in carbon, not fiberglass, I will make the big vents an Aero benefit as well versus just holes in the hood, They will go down further on the ramped side so that the vented opening is facing toward the radiator versus aimed at the ground. This will give the air that hits the surface a downforce creating plane to hit versus just a hole that then vents along the ramp. A narrow simplified Airbox will need to be part of the mix as well.
I would love to make a clamshell but then it would have to incorporate major surgery for pretty much a similar look when the hood is closed and the Gen 3/4 has the inner fender supports that would have to be replaced etc etc etc. It would be easy in the future to make the car look like a gen 5 though, we recently added a PU (poly Urethane) line to the production mix so bumpers and fenders will be easier to make.
